Custodial Fund definition

Custodial Fund or “Fund” means the fund maintained in accordance with the terms of this Agreement, including both the Cash Account and the Investment Account.
Custodial Fund means a fund or funds managed by the Foundation pursuant to a custodial fund agreement wherein the Funds are not owned by the Foundation.
Custodial Fund means the fund established by the Employer as a convenient method of setting aside a portion of its assets to meet its obligations under the Plan, as provided in Section 5.1. The Custodial Fund shall be composed of the total of all assets held by the Custodians (including Contracts issued under the Plan to the Employer by any Custodian) in accordance with the terms of the Plan. The portion of the Custodial Fund held by each Custodian shall constitute a custodial account or contract (within the meaning of Sections 401(f) and 457(g)(3) of the Code).
